31/07/2025: A small lunch bar with lovely drinks and great sandwiches. Also a very good place for coffee. The service is very friendly, personal and inclusive. These people have their hearts in the right place and run a great business at the same time. Highly recommended! Especially before or after visiting the Violin Museum, as this bar is located exactly where the workplace of Stradivari, Guarneri, Bergonzi and Amati used to be. To violin lovers this Café is on holy ground, and they don't even advertise this fact.
